Frequently Asked Questions about Fairmount Heights Apartments with Washer/Dryer

What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Fairmount Heights?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Fairmount Heights with Washer/Dryer is at 4923 Brooks St NE, Unit 1 listed at $1,200.

How much is the average rent for Fairmount Heights Apartments with Washer/Dryer?

The average rent for a Apartment in Fairmount Heights with Washer/Dryer is $2,255.

What is the largest Fairmount Heights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?

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Fairmount Heights is a 1,233 square feet unit starting from $1,682 at Addison Row.

What is the average size for Fairmount Heights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?

The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Fairmount Heights is currently at 695 sq ft.
